E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Lambda表达式
JavaSE进阶15:XML、注解、JUnit单元测试
系列文章目录JavaSE进阶01:继承、修饰符JavaSE进阶02:多态、抽象类、接口JavaSE进阶03:内部类、
Lambda表达式
JavaSE进阶04:API中常用工具类JavaSE进阶05:包装类
XXXZhy
·
2023-10-16 13:10
JAVA进阶笔记
JAVA
Java 8 新增操作集合的方法
Predicate是函数式接口,因此可以
Lambda表达式
作为参数books.removeIf(elem->((String)elem).le
jayvee_
·
2023-10-16 12:02
Java
java
C++11(
lambda表达式
)
目录一、
lambda表达式
的引入二、语法格式三、捕捉方式四、
lambda表达式
的底层1、仿函数的调用2、lambda的调用编辑一、
lambda表达式
的引入在之前,我们调用函数的方式有:通过函数指针调用,
dbln
·
2023-10-16 09:51
c++
开发语言
Java8新特性
http://docs.oracle.com/javase/8/docs/technotes/guides/language/enhancements.html#javase8)Collections二、[
lambda
SGdan_qi
·
2023-10-16 05:10
java
java
Java8新特性实战
Java8引入的核心新特性包括:
Lambda表达式
、函数式接口、Stream流API、方法引用/构造器引用等。1.什么是行为参数化行为参数化是Java8增加的一个编程概念,即把不
G_J_M
·
2023-10-16 04:51
Jdk8新特性
Java
函数式编程
java_方法引用和构造器引用
文章目录一、方法引用1.1、方法引用的理解1.2、格式1.3、举例二、构造器引用2.1、格式2.2、例子2.3、数组引用一、方法引用1.1、方法引用的理解方法引用,可以看做是基于
lambda表达式
的进一步刻画当需要提供一个函数式接口的实例时
珍珠是蚌的眼泪
·
2023-10-16 02:12
Java
java
intellij-idea
方法引用
构造器引用
数组引用
【C++11】
2.1auto2.2decltype2.3nullptr三、STL的变化四、右值引用和移动4.1左值引用与右值引用4.2右值引用的场景和意义4.3完美转发4.4完美转发的某个应用场景四、lambda4.1
lambda
龙里出生的蛋
·
2023-10-16 00:17
c++
Java
Lambda表达式
Lambda表达式
(Lambdaexpression)是一个匿名函数,基于数学中的λ演算得名,也可称为闭包(Closure)。
哆啦哆啦S梦
·
2023-10-15 23:06
java
python
开发语言
Java
Lambda表达式
的使用方法及总结
下面将
Lambda表达式
的使用共分为六种情况介绍,代码块上半部分为原有方式,下半部分为使用
Lambda表达式
的简化方式,从而使我们进一步体会使用
Lambda表达式
的便捷之处①格式一:无参,无返回值//在这里我们使用创建多线程的
不会写代码的菜
·
2023-10-15 23:06
java
Lambda表达式
Java入门
java小白
java
开发语言
后端
java中lambda中使用三元,Java中使用
Lambda表达式
一查资料才知道是
Lambda表达式
,Java在Version8中引入了该特性。不得不说自己有太久没有主动学习过新的东西,刚好项目忙过,能够抽空学习下
Lambda表达式
。
巴罗尔的凝视
·
2023-10-15 23:05
java
lambda表达式
if_Java8
Lambda表达式
的使用
参考为什么要用
Lambda表达式
?
Lambda表达式
可以让我们用较少的代码来实现更多的功能,尤其在Java这种相对来说比较“啰嗦”的语言中,是一把提高效率的利器。
weixin_39759441
·
2023-10-15 23:05
java
lambda表达式
if
Java
Lambda表达式
的使用
本节主要介绍在Java中如何使用
Lambda表达式
。作为参数使用
Lambda表达式
Lambda表达式
一种常见的用途就是作为参数传递给方法,这需要声明参数的类型声明为函数式接口类型。
哆啦哆啦S梦
·
2023-10-15 23:33
java
python
开发语言
【C++】C++11 ——
lambda表达式
个人主页:@Sherry的成长之路学习社区:Sherry的成长之路(个人社区)专栏链接:C++学习长路漫漫浩浩,万事皆有期待上一篇博客:【C++】C++11———可变参数模板文章目录
lambda表达式
lambda
Sherry的成长之路
·
2023-10-15 22:36
C++学习
c++
redis
匿名类
一、匿名类及用
lambda表达式
实现匿名类//不使用lambda,new后的Comparable指定匿名类类型,故需要带泛型Comparablec3=newComparable(){@OverridepublicintcompareTo
小小書童可笑可笑
·
2023-10-15 17:03
Python字典的排序方法
方法一:使用sorted()函数和
lambda表达式
一个简单的方法是使用sorted()函数结合
lambda表达式
来对字典进行排序。通过指定排序的键(
pytorchCode
·
2023-10-15 16:06
python
开发语言
前端
Python
python字典、列表排序,从简单到复杂
list)等进行各种各样的排序,发现网上这块的资料又多又杂,尤其涉及到lambda的,让人觉得难以理解看不下去,因此写了这篇文章,从简单到复杂,配合例子一点点讲解对字典、列表的各种排序,并按照自己的理解对
lambda
Smart_Maggie
·
2023-10-15 16:02
python
字典排序
列表排序
python
sorted
Python多线程多进程、异步、异常处理等高级用法
文章目录前言多线程多进程多线程多进程协程总结异步基本概念异步编程asyncioaiohttp异常常见异常异常处理自定义异常
lambda表达式
lambda表达式
用法高阶函数functoolsitertools
RyanC3
·
2023-10-15 14:58
#
python
python
开发语言
后端
C#学习相关系列之匿名方法和
Lambda表达式
在C#中,匿名方法通常表现为使用delegate运算符和
Lambda表达式
。(
Lambda表达式
的本质也是匿名方法。
大花爱编程
·
2023-10-15 13:45
C#从入门到精通系列
c#
学习
Jdk1.8 流式编程及
Lambda表达式
详解
目录(一)
Lambda表达式
(二)方法引用(三)流式编程详细方法(一)
Lambda表达式
Functionfunction=()->System.out.println("我来自
Lambda表达式
");function.run
Luiiis
·
2023-10-15 12:44
学习总结
教程
java
Java创建线程(
Lambda表达式
创建线程)
一、创建线程三种方式1.1继承Thread类创建线程类(main线程与t线程交替执行)1.2通过Runnable接口创建线程类弊端是:不能直接使用Thread中的方法需要先获取到线程对象后,才能得到Thread的方法,代码复杂上述代码中Thread.currentThread()方法返回当前正在执行的线程对象。GetName()方法返回调用该方法的线程的名字。publicclassRunnable
weixin_55451557
·
2023-10-15 12:55
java
开发语言
四、C++语言进阶:Boost入门
4.2使用4.2.1lamdba表达式lambda库通过创建一个匿名的
lambda表达式
来代替实名的函数对象HelloWorld.cpp#include#includeusingnamespaceboost
_深蓝.
·
2023-10-15 12:19
C++进阶
c++
linux
开发语言
Kotlin 学习笔记 五:函数和
lambda表达式
注意事项:1:只要在一个函数的函数体实现中再次调用了函数本身,就是递归函数。递归函数一定要向已知方向进行2.函数只返回单个表达式,则可以用等号=即可funarea(x:Double):Double=x,而对于单表达式函数而言,编译器可以自动推断函数的返回值类型,因此也可以改为funarea(x:Double)=x3.Kotlin允许调用函数时通过名字来传入参数值,因此,Kotlin函数的参数名应该
嗯先生
·
2023-10-15 10:28
Kotlin笔记(一):Lambda,非空判断,函数默认参数
1.
Lambda表达式
Lambda就是一小段可以作为参数传递的代码,在kotlin中的标准形式为:{参数名1:参数类型,参数名2:参数类型->函数体} 标准形式使用如下:vallist=listOf(
ZWaruler
·
2023-10-15 10:24
Kotlin
kotlin
java8到java17的蜕变
https://blog.csdn.net/weixin_72388638/article/details/131691554目录一、前言二、JAVA8
Lambda表达式
StreamAPI创建方式中间操作终止操作
Micrle_007
·
2023-10-15 09:53
Java
windows
linux
microsoft
使用QT开发
界面项目编辑(3)、根据向导创建QT项目3、第一个QT程序:4、按钮的创建和属性设置:5、对象树:6、信号和槽:7、自定义信号和槽:(1)、无参--信号和槽(2)、有参--信号和槽(3)、信号和槽的总结8、
lambda
1天道酬勤1
·
2023-10-15 09:22
Qt开发
qt
开发语言
嵌入式养成计划-41----C++ auto--
lambda表达式
--C++中的数据类型转换--C++标准模板库(STL)--list--C++文件操作
九十九、auto99.1概念C++11引入了自动类型推导,和Python不一样,C++中的自动类型推导,需要auto关键字来引导比如:autoa=1.2;会被编译器自动识别为a为double类型99.2作用auto修饰变量,可以自动推导变量的数据类型。99.3注意auto修饰变量时,必须初始化auto的右值,可以是右值,可以是表达式,可以函数的返回值auto不能修饰函数的形参auto不能修饰数组a
zhk___
·
2023-10-15 07:24
C/C++
c++
list
开发语言
【spring】spring如何解决bean的循环依赖
通过三级缓存(map)2.一级缓存:存储完整的Bean,(关键是一定要有一个缓存保存它的早期对象作为死循环的出口)3.二级缓存:避免多重循环依赖的情况,重复创建动态代理4.三级缓存:缓存的是函数接口,通过
lambda
王佑辉
·
2023-10-15 07:22
spring
面试
spring
java
Stream流中的常用方法(forEach,filter,map,count,limit,skip,concat)和Stream流的特点
1、forEach方法该方法接收一个Consumer接口是一个消费型的函数式接口,可以传递
Lambda表达式
,消费数据用来遍历流中的数据,是一个终结方法,遍历之后就不能继续调用Stream流中的其他方法
丁总学Java
·
2023-10-15 06:08
#
Stream
forEach
filter
map
count
limit
skip
concat
Qt匿名函数的写法
匿名函数也可以被叫做
Lambda表达式
,自C++11中引入该特性。本文主要介绍Qt里使用到的匿名函数。
luckyone906
·
2023-10-15 05:04
Qt-常用汇总
QT
qt
开发语言
c++
委托,事件,回调,匿名函数与
Lambda表达式
详解
1.委托听到很多人这样描述委托:比如说,你是一个程序,现在正在做一款产品,而需要用到的模型是你不会做的,于是你委托你的一位同事来帮你做模型部分。这就是委托,而中文的字面描述意思也是这样,委托委托,把你自己所不能做或者没时间做的事情交给其他人去做,而怎么知道是哪个人去做的,就需要我们告诉他。委托在微软《C#编程指南》中是这样描述的Delegate是表示对具有特定参数列表和返回类型的方法的引用的类型,
拿起键盘就是干
·
2023-10-15 00:17
编程指南
【数组、ArrayList 、TreeMap的排序方法】自定义类如何排序,存入数组排序、存入ArrayList排序、存入TreeMap排序
Array.sort3ArrayList排序,两种调用排序的方法1、list.sort(比较器);2、Collections.sort(list,比较器);4TreeMap排序,三种new时有排序的方法1、newTreeMap参数用
lambda
_esther_
·
2023-10-15 00:08
Java语法
java
开发语言
Kotlin笔记(二):标准函数,静态方法,延迟初始化,密封类
操作符来进行辅助判空处理.1.1with函数 with函数接收两个参数:第一个参数可以是一个任意类型的对象,第二个参数是一个
Lambda表达式
。
ZWaruler
·
2023-10-15 00:57
Kotlin
kotlin
C++11新特性
C++11包括大量的新特性:包括
lambda表达式
,类型推导关键字auto、decltype,和模板的大量改进等等。本文将对C++11的以上新特性进行
无止境x
·
2023-10-14 20:48
for
job
C++
11
C#里 =>的用法
问题看到有人写这样的代码,这里的=>让人感到疑惑,我一直以为它是
Lambda表达式
的写法,跟C++的->类似,比较好理解,但是明显下面这里的代码不是属于
Lambda表达式
的范围//这里的MaxHealth1
弹吉他的小刘鸭
·
2023-10-14 17:55
C#语言
【Java 8的新特性】
目录引言1.
Lambda表达式
理解
Lambda表达式
Lambda表达式
的优势1.减少样板代码2.更好的可读性3.支持函数式编程在实际项目中使用La
余晖qwq
·
2023-10-14 17:24
java学习手记
java
python
开发语言
【C++】Lambda 表达式详解
语法糖:
Lambda表达式
一、
Lambda表达式
简介二、
Lambda表达式
语法解析1.Lambdaexp基本语法结构2.捕获变量的几种方式3.mutable关键字三、
Lambda表达式
使用示例四、探究
Lambda
代码被吃掉了
·
2023-10-14 16:14
C++
c++
lambda
C++
lambda表达式
std::function 深层详解
lambda的使用语法按值捕获和按引用捕获的对比
lambda表达式
的类型lambda的作用域mutablelambdaslambda的大小lambda的性能表现std::functionstd::function
supermax2020
·
2023-10-14 16:14
C++
c++
lambda
C++
lambda表达式
详解
lambda表达式
一、
lambda表达式
基本用法1、语法2、lambda值捕获3、lambda引用捕获4、lambda隐式捕获5、
lambda表达式
捕获6、泛型lambda二、
lambda表达式
与algorithm
牛马不分
·
2023-10-14 16:13
c++11
c++
C++中的
Lambda表达式
一.前言最近博主在LeetCode上刷题时意中碰到435.无重叠区间这道题,题目:给定一个区间的集合intervals,其中intervals[i]=[starti,endi]。返回需要移除区间的最小数量,使剩余区间互不重叠。乍一看这不就是活动安排问题嘛,如何安排活动使得不冲突的活动数量最多,下面是博主最初提交的题解:boolcompare(vectors1,vectors2){returns1[
斯曦巍峨
·
2023-10-14 16:08
C/C++
c++
贪心算法
算法
C++中的
Lambda表达式
详解
C++中的
Lambda表达式
详解简介:
Lambda表达式
(又称Lambda函数,英文原文是LambdaExpression),是C++11的新特性中非常实用的一个。
qq_21291397
·
2023-10-14 16:37
Qt基础
c++
lambda
C ++
Lambda表达式
详解
C++
Lambda表达式
详解1.
Lambda表达式
概述
Lambda表达式
是现代C++在C++11和更高版本中的一个新的语法糖,在C++11、C++14、C++17和C++20中Lambda表达的内容还在不断更新
奥修的灵魂
·
2023-10-14 16:26
C++学习
C++ 11 lamdba表达式详解
C++lamdba表达式
Lambda表达式
是C++11引入的一个新特性,它允许我们在需要函数对象的地方,使用一种更加简洁的方式定义匿名函数。
unordered_set
·
2023-10-14 16:26
c++
个人开发
Apache-Flink中的Java泛型与
Lambda表达式
在使用Java编写apache-flink程序的时候相信很多新手都遇到下面这样的异常;org.apache.flink.api.common.functions.InvalidTypesException:Thereturntypeoffunction'main(DemoApp.java:29)'couldnotbedeterminedautomatically,duetotypeerasur
solinx
·
2023-10-14 15:32
【日常业务开发】代码简洁之道
代码简洁之道利用语法利用三元表达式利用for-each语句利用try-with-resource语句利用return关键字利用static关键字利用
lambda表达式
利用方法引用利用静态导入利用unchecked
喜羊羊sk
·
2023-10-14 13:03
#
日常业务开发
java
Lambda 表达式使用详解,一篇文章手把手教会你
目录1.
Lambda表达式
有什么用?2.匿名内部类举例3.
Lambda表达式
的标准格式与使用4.
Lambda表达式
使用注意点5.什么是函数式接口?
程序猿ZhangSir
·
2023-10-14 13:28
排序算法
java
算法
开发常用的Stream流+
Lambda表达式
过滤元素了解过吗?10000字超详细解析
目录1.Stream流的简单展示1.1抛出问题1.2传统解决问题的编码方式1.3Stream流的方式过滤元素2.Stream流的核心思想3.Stream流的使用3.1获取stream流3.1.1单列集合获取stream流3.1.2双列集合获取stream流3.1.3数组获取stream流3.1.4零散数据获取stream流3.2处理加工stream流3.2.1stream流常用的方法3.2.2fi
程序猿ZhangSir
·
2023-10-14 13:28
java
(七)Python函数和
lambda表达式
函数就是一段封装好的,可以重复使用的代码,它使得我们的程序更加模块化,不需要编写大量重复的代码。函数可以提前保存起来,并给它起一个独一无二的名字,只要知道它的名字就能使用这段代码。函数还可以接收数据,并根据数据的不同做出不同的操作,最后再把处理结果反馈给我们。本章不仅会介绍Python定义和使用函数的基本语法,还有很多高级的函数用法(例如lambda匿名函数),都会为你一一详解。一、Python函
别致的SmallSix
·
2023-10-14 12:52
Python语言学习
python
开发语言
java8的特性
一、
Lambda表达式
Lambda表达式
可以说是Java8最大的卖点,她将函数式编程引入了Java。Lambda允许把函数作为一个方法的参数,或者把代码看成数据。
Clovemeo
·
2023-10-14 12:22
Java语言
std::function 简介
std::function的实例可以存储、复制和调用任何可复制构造的可调用目标,包括普通函数、成员函数、类对象(重载了operator()的类的对象)、
Lambda表达式
等。
workingwei
·
2023-10-14 10:02
C/C++基础
c++
java Stream详解看我这一篇就够了
Stream和IOStream不是一类东西,Stream是Java8API添加的一个新的抽象,为什么使用Stream流:使用Stream流是对集合(Collection)对象功能的增强,与
Lambda表达式
结合
person想要改变
·
2023-10-14 07:59
java
开发语言
上一页
21
22
23
24
25
26
27
28
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他